A Much Afflicted Family.

Mr. and Mrs. J. C. Fisher and Mrs. G. W. Terwilliger his sister, arrived home Tuesday night lrom attending the funeral of their brother, Cland Fisher, at Urliana, 111. He died there on Jan. 11th, of pneumonia, after a sickness of only four days’ duration. He died in the 9amo house aud of the same disease as his brother-in law, Frank Blancett, about two weeks before. He-was only a little past 19 years old, and a young man of excellent character and promise. The funeral was held at tlrbana, on Saturday, Jan., 13th. This is the third time within two weeks that Mr. Fisher and Mrs. Terwilliger have been call away ,to attend the funerals of near relatives. Besides this brother, and the brother-in law, Mr. Blancett, the other was that of a little danghter of their brother,[ Zell Fisher, formerly of Rensselaer now of Bluftton. She was three years old and her death occured a week before that of Claud's.
